Lodhapur Population - Azamgarh, Uttar Pradesh
Lodhapur is a medium size village located in Lalganj Tehsil of Azamgarh district, Uttar Pradesh with total 68 families residing. The Lodhapur village has population of 483 of which 232 are males while 251 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Lodhap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 62 which makes up 12.84 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Lodhapur village is 1082 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Lodhapur as per census is 879,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Lodhapur village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Lodhapur village was 83.85 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Lodhapur Male literacy stands at 89.95 % while female literacy rate was 78.38 %.

Lodhapur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 68 | - | - |
Population | 483 | 232 | 251 |
Child (0-6) | 62 | 33 | 29 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 83.85 % | 89.95 % | 78.38 % |
Total Workers | 83 | 81 | 2 |
Main Worker | 62 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 21 | 20 | 1 |
